Boards Comment – Film Noir Lighting

Film noir is all about contrasts and how light is used to tell a story -- i.e. a character moving from a shadow into light.

It should be shot in B&W from the get go.

Consider the characters in the original '64 Fail Safe:

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=H0ToOVstAnU

and the 2000 Fail Safe:

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=djqlAT-7be4

The difference speaks for itself. The original noir -- the highlights are actully burned and the shadows are unrecoverrable. Anything else and it will look like the cheesy 2000 home video conversion ;)
